Average Acceleration from Velocity Vector

A particle moves in a plane with velocity $$\vec{v} = (3t^2 \hat{i} + 4t^3 \hat{j})$$ m/s, where $$t$$ is in seconds. What is the magnitude of the average acceleration vector between $$t = 1$$ s and $$t = 2$$ s?

A

9$$\sqrt{13}$$ m/s²

B

13 m/s²

C

$$\sqrt{865}$$ m/s²

D

5$$\sqrt{13}$$ m/s²
